The Omega3 Omega 3 Market continues to grow as consumers place greater emphasis on nutrition, heart health, and overall wellness. Omega-3 ingredients are widely used in dietary supplements, functional foods, pharmaceuticals, and even personal care products. Their broad application base makes them one of the most important nutritional ingredients in the global health market.

One of the biggest drivers of growth is rising consumer awareness of preventive health. People increasingly seek ingredients that support cardiovascular health, brain function, and inflammation management. This has made omega-3 products highly popular in capsule, softgel, liquid, powder, and fortified food formats. Manufacturers continue to expand their offerings to meet demand across different user preferences and age groups.

Sourcing trends are also influencing market development. Fish oil remains a major source, but algae oil and krill oil are becoming more important due to sustainability concerns and plant-based consumer demand. Algae-based omega-3 products are especially attractive to vegetarian and vegan buyers, as well as brands focused on cleaner sourcing. This shift is encouraging more innovation in formulation and product positioning.

The market is no longer limited to supplements alone. Functional beverages, fortified dairy products, nutrition bars, and pharmaceutical applications are all contributing to growth. This diversification helps reduce reliance on one category and allows brands to reach consumers through multiple channels. It also supports premium product development in health-focused segments.

North America and Europe remain leading markets due to high awareness and mature supplement industries. Asia-Pacific is emerging as a strong growth region, supported by urbanization, rising incomes, and growing interest in preventive nutrition. Companies that can offer transparency, clinical credibility, and sustainable sourcing are likely to remain competitive in the years ahead.
